The Dominion Theatre, Home to AN AMERICAN IN PARIS Completes £6m Refurbishment
by A.A. Cristi - Aug 7, 2017


London's Dominion Theatre, home to Christopher Wheeldon's stunning reinvention of the Oscar winning Hollywood musical An American in Paris, has completed a £6 million restoration and unveils a brand new double-sided LED screen on Tottenham Court Road, the largest and highest resolution projecting screen on the exterior of a West End theatre.

Rehearsals Begin in London for AN AMERICAN IN PARIS
by BWW News Desk - Jan 16, 2017


Rehearsals begin in London today for the highly anticipated new West End musical An American in Paris. Christopher Wheeldon's stunning reinvention of the Oscar winning film (that starred Gene Kelly and Leslie Caron) features the sublime music and lyrics of George Gershwin and Ira Gershwin and a new book by Craig Lucas.

Photo Coverage: Patricia Hodge In Stiles And Drewe's TRAVELS WITH MY AUNT
by Roy Tan - Apr 26, 2016


Retired bank manager Henry Pulling is happy alone with his dahlias until he meets his decidedly bohemian Aunt Augusta who, having rattled the family skeletons, persuades the reluctant Henry to flee to Europe. He finds himself in a luxurious whirl through Paris and Istanbul and on to South America; but alongside the romance and first-class thrills, there's a lot Henry doesn't know about his aunt - particularly why she has so many grateful men dotted around the globe.

Photo Flash: Sail On! First Look at Mirvish's Reimagined TITANIC in Toronto; Could It Port on Broadway?
by Nicole Rosky - May 22, 2015


TITANIC is part of the Mirvish 2014-15 Subscription Season, playing through June 21, 2015 at Toronto's Princess of Wales Theatre. In this new reimagining of the musical, director Thom Southerland uses an ensemble cast, meaning that everyone in the cast plays two or three or more roles in the telling of the story.
